Nom de Variables

Le
Alain Desaivres
Bonjour

Est-il possible de construire le nom d'une variable vba en concaténant des
string et si oui comment? Un peu comme l'on fait dans une cellule d'une
feuille de calcul avec la fonction "INDIRECT". L'objectif est de pouvoir
simplifier des boucles de code qui travaille sur des variables dont les noms
sont très proches les uns des autres

Ex =>
dim USDversusEUR_rate as double
USDversuEUR_rate = 1,5
l'instruction msgbox USDversusEUR_rate va bien donner 1,5 affiché ds une
fenêtre

comment faire la même chose en reconstruisant
le nom de la variable à partir d'une string "str"
Ex =>
dim str as string
str = "versusEUR_rate"
comment faire dans cette situation pour appeller la variable
en partant de la construction de son nom à partir de
"USD & str

J'ai bien fait des recherches dans les thread mais n'ai aboutis à rien
Merci à vous
Alain
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Daniel.C
Le #6708641
Bonjour.
Je ne pense pas que tu le puisses.
Cordialement.
Daniel
"Alain Desaivres" message de news:
Bonjour

Est-il possible de construire le nom d'une variable vba en concaténant des
string et si oui comment? Un peu comme l'on fait dans une cellule d'une
feuille de calcul avec la fonction "INDIRECT". L'objectif est de pouvoir
simplifier des boucles de code qui travaille sur des variables dont les
noms
sont très proches les uns des autres...

Ex =>
dim USDversusEUR_rate as double
USDversuEUR_rate = 1,5
l'instruction msgbox USDversusEUR_rate va bien donner 1,5 affiché ds une
fenêtre

comment faire la même chose en reconstruisant
le nom de la variable à partir d'une string "str"
Ex =>
dim str as string
str = "versusEUR_rate"
comment faire dans cette situation pour appeller la variable
en partant de la construction de son nom à partir de
"USD & str

J'ai bien fait des recherches dans les thread mais n'ai aboutis à rien...
Merci à vous
Alain


JB
Le #6708631
On 26 mai, 10:17, Alain Desaivres
Bonjour

Est-il possible de construire le nom d'une variable vba en concaténant d es
string et si oui comment? Un peu comme l'on fait dans une cellule d'une
feuille de calcul avec la fonction "INDIRECT". L'objectif est de pouvoir
simplifier des boucles de code qui travaille sur des variables dont les no ms
sont très proches les uns des autres...

Ex =>
dim USDversusEUR_rate as double
USDversuEUR_rate = 1,5
l'instruction msgbox USDversusEUR_rate va bien donner 1,5 affiché ds une
fenêtre
Bonjour,


Pour les formulaires seulement.

http://boisgontierjacques.free.fr/pages_site/formchampindices.htm

JB
http://boisgontierjacques.free.fr/


comment faire la même chose en reconstruisant
le nom de la variable à partir d'une string "str"
Ex =>
dim str as string
str = "versusEUR_rate"
comment faire dans cette situation pour appeller la variable
en partant de la construction de son nom à partir de  
"USD & str

J'ai bien fait des recherches dans les thread mais n'ai aboutis à rien.. .
Merci à vous
Alain


Publicité
Poster une réponse
Anonyme